In three to four sentences, describe how Poe uses imagery and sound devices to create mood in "The Raven.
elena-14-01-66 [18.8K]
Sample Response: <span>Poe uses images that appeal to the senses of sound, sight, and touch. At first, these images create a gloomy, mysterious, and tense mood. Then, the mood becomes haunting. Sound devices, such as the repetition of the name “Lenore” and its constant rhyming with “nevermore,” create a slow, haunting sound that further contributes to the spooky mood.</span>
